Storing heart rate belts within a robust warehouse storage facility offers significant advantages for both product protection and inventory management. Warehouses provide a secure, organized environment ideal for maintaining the quality and integrity of these sensitive devices. Proper racking systems are crucial, utilizing adjustable shelving to accommodate varying box sizes and ensuring easy access for picking and packing. Dedicated storage zones based on batch numbers or product variations will streamline order fulfillment and minimize the risk of confusion. Boxes should be placed on stable surfaces, away from direct sunlight and potential physical impact. Regular inventory audits, facilitated by a warehouse management system, guarantee accurate stock levels and optimize stock rotation, prioritizing older stock to prevent prolonged storage. The controlled environment of a warehouse, with consistent lighting and ventilation, contributes to a stable storage atmosphere, safeguarding the belts from dust and debris. Finally, a warehouse’s secure access and tracking capabilities provide enhanced traceability and reduce the risk of loss or damage, making it a strategically advantageous location for heart rate belt storage.
Storage Size/Dimensions: Minimum 200 square feet or a 15ft x 13ft area. Height clearance: 12 feet. This allows for efficient storage and movement.
Storage Conditions: The storage area should be dry and well-ventilated. Dust and debris should be minimized. Avoid direct sunlight exposure. The floor should be level and clean.
Special Handling: Heart rate belts are considered fragile items. Each unit should be individually wrapped in protective padding (bubble wrap or foam). Palletizing is recommended for larger quantities to prevent damage during handling.
Stacking/Shelving: Utilize shelving units with adjustable shelves to accommodate different belt sizes. Shelves should be spaced approximately 18 inches apart for easy access. Consider using pallet racking for bulk storage if space allows. Maximum stacking height: 5 shelves.
Access Requirements: A standard 12ft x 10ft loading dock is required for receiving and shipping. Door width: 10 feet. A minimum clearance of 8 feet is needed at the loading dock for forklift operation. Secondary access door: 8ft x 7ft with 6ft clearance.
